#e15666 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e15666 is composed of 88.2% red, 33.7% green and 40%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 61.8% magenta, 54.7%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 353.1 degrees, a saturation of 69.8% and a lightness of 61%. #e15666 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ffaccc with #c30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

Shades and Tints of #e15666

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0304 is the darkest color, while #fffd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#e15666

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9c9b9b is the less saturated color, while #f83f54 is the most saturated one.
